当前位置:首页 > 数控编程 > 正文

数控小车编程

数控小车编程是现代工业自动化领域中不可或缺的一部分,其核心在于通过计算机程序实现对小车运动轨迹的精确控制。在本文中,我们将从专业角度出发,探讨数控小车编程的关键技术和实现方法。

数控小车编程通常涉及以下几个关键环节:运动规划、路径规划、运动学计算、代码编写以及仿真验证。以下将逐一阐述。

运动规划是数控小车编程的基础。它主要包括确定小车的起始位置、目标位置以及运动轨迹。在实际应用中,运动规划需要考虑多种因素,如小车负载、速度、加速度等。通过对这些参数的合理设定,可以确保小车在运动过程中平稳、高效地完成各项任务。

数控小车编程

路径规划是数控小车编程的核心。它主要解决如何在复杂环境中为小车规划出一条最优路径。路径规划算法众多,如A算法、Dijkstra算法等。在实际应用中,根据具体场景选择合适的算法,可以显著提高编程效率。

再次,运动学计算是数控小车编程的关键技术之一。它主要包括求解小车在运动过程中的位置、速度、加速度等参数。运动学计算方法有多种,如解析法、数值法等。在实际应用中,根据小车运动特性选择合适的计算方法,可以保证编程精度。

接下来,代码编写是数控小车编程的实践环节。根据前述运动规划和运动学计算结果,编写相应的程序代码,实现对小车运动的精确控制。在代码编写过程中,需要遵循以下原则:

数控小车编程

1. 结构清晰:将程序分为模块,便于阅读和维护。

2. 代码规范:遵循编程规范,提高代码可读性。

3. 精简代码:避免冗余代码,提高程序执行效率。

4. 异常处理:充分考虑各种异常情况,确保程序稳定运行。

数控小车编程

仿真验证是数控小车编程的重要环节。通过仿真软件对编写的程序进行测试,可以提前发现潜在问题,为实际应用提供有力保障。仿真验证主要包括以下内容:

1. 模拟小车运动轨迹,验证路径规划的正确性。

2. 检查运动学计算结果,确保程序执行精度。

3. 分析程序运行过程中的性能指标,如响应时间、稳定性等。

4. 优化程序,提高小车运动性能。

数控小车编程是一门涉及多个领域的综合性技术。在实际应用中,我们需要根据具体场景选择合适的编程方法,以确保小车在运动过程中稳定、高效地完成任务。通过本文的探讨,相信读者对数控小车编程有了更深入的了解。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050